简体中文简体中文
EnglishEnglish
简体中文简体中文

离线下载与源码获取:深度解析现代网络技术下的便捷

2025-01-20 12:28:51

随着互联网技术的飞速发展,网络资源的获取变得越来越便捷。然而,在网络连接不稳定或者数据流量受限的情况下,离线下载和源码获取成为了我们获取资源的重要途径。本文将深入探讨离线下载和源码获取的相关技术,以及它们在现代网络环境下的应用。

一、离线下载

离线下载,顾名思义,指的是在网络断开连接的情况下,将所需的文件下载到本地存储设备中。这种下载方式在以下几种情况下尤为实用:

1.网络连接不稳定:在移动网络或偏远地区,网络信号不稳定,下载速度慢,甚至时常断线。此时,离线下载可以保证文件的完整性,提高下载效率。

2.数据流量受限:部分用户的数据流量有限,频繁的在线下载会导致流量消耗过快。离线下载可以减少流量消耗,降低资费负担。

3.需要长期保存的文件:对于一些重要的学习资料、工作文件等,用户可能需要长期保存。离线下载可以将这些文件下载到本地,方便随时查阅。

离线下载的实现方式主要有以下几种:

1.下载工具:市面上有许多离线下载工具,如迅雷、IDM等。这些工具支持批量下载、断点续传等功能,使用方便。

2.离线下载网站:部分网站提供离线下载服务,用户只需输入文件链接,即可将文件下载到本地。

3.自定义脚本:对于有一定编程基础的用户,可以编写自定义脚本实现离线下载。例如,使用Python的requests库,可以编写一个简单的离线下载脚本。

二、源码获取

源码获取,指的是获取软件、网站等产品的原始代码。这对于开发者、研究者以及爱好者来说,具有重要的意义。以下是源码获取的几种途径:

1.官方渠道:许多开源项目会在官方网站上提供源码下载。用户只需访问项目主页,即可找到源码下载链接。

2.源码托管平台:GitHub、GitLab等源码托管平台,为开发者提供了一个集中存放和管理源码的场所。用户可以在这些平台上搜索、下载感兴趣的项目源码。

3.第三方网站:部分第三方网站会收集整理开源项目的源码,并提供下载。但需要注意的是,下载这些源码时要确保来源可靠,避免下载到恶意代码。

4.自行编译:对于一些开源软件,用户可以根据官方文档,自行编译源码。这需要一定的编程基础,但可以深入了解软件的内部机制。

三、离线下载与源码获取在现代网络环境下的应用

1.研发与测试:在软件开发过程中,离线下载和源码获取可以方便地获取到所需资源,提高研发效率。同时,开发者可以通过源码分析,发现潜在的问题,提高软件质量。

2.教育与学习:离线下载和源码获取为学习者提供了丰富的学习资源。学生可以通过学习源码,了解编程语言、框架等知识,提高自己的技术水平。

3.创新与创业:离线下载和源码获取有助于创业者快速搭建项目原型,降低创业成本。同时,创业者可以借鉴开源项目的优秀设计,提高自身产品的竞争力。

总之,离线下载和源码获取在现代网络环境下具有重要意义。掌握相关技术,将有助于我们在网络资源获取、软件开发、教育与学习等方面取得更好的成果。